Webb25 aug. 2016 · It would not be tough to get long range imagery, for example photographing planets from a distance of 50 million miles, but it's hard to justify an interstellar mission … WebbProxima Centauri b is a super Earth exoplanet that orbits an M-type star. Its mass is 1.07 Earths, it takes 11.2 days to complete one orbit of its star, and is 0.04856 AU from its star. The distance to … bosch glm165-27c manualbosch glm165-27cg reviewWebb12 sep. 2024 · 20 to 25 years This laser would accelerate the probes to 20 percent the speed of light (about 134.12 million mph, or 215.85 million km/h), according to the program scientists. At that rate, the probes could reach Proxima Centauri in 20 to 25 years.
